The Role As the Mechanical Services Manager, you will oversee and supervise the mechanical services team and contractors, ensuring that statutory, planned, and reactive maintenance is delivered to both the main and remote campuses in line with agreed SLAs. Your responsibilities will include setting up and renewing contractor provisions, managing the team's workload using the Planon CAFM system (training provided), and ensuring all work is carried out safely and efficiently. You will also be responsible for meeting and greeting contractors, explaining issues to facilitate effective repair solutions, ensuring value for money, and managing health and safety requirements. This role is hands-on, requiring you to actively support and mentor mechanical technicians and apprentices, lead responses to emergency mechanical issues, and audit contractors' work Our Successful Candidate We are looking for experienced mechanical services managers, mechanical supervisors, or senior technicians ready to step into a managerial role. You should have a background in managing and maintaining mechanical installations. Ideally, you will hold qualifications equivalent to HNC/NVQ Level 3 or have demonstrable equivalent experience.
